Richard L. Naeye is a scholar working on Pediatrics, Perinatology and Child Health, Pulmonary and Respiratory Medicine and Obstetrics and Gynecology. According to data from OpenAlex, Richard L. Naeye has authored 187 papers receiving a total of 7.5k indexed citations (citations by other indexed papers that have themselves been cited), including 85 papers in Pediatrics, Perinatology and Child Health, 66 papers in Pulmonary and Respiratory Medicine and 51 papers in Obstetrics and Gynecology. Recurrent topics in Richard L. Naeye's work include Birth, Development, and Health (43 papers), Pregnancy and preeclampsia studies (42 papers) and Neonatal Respiratory Health Research (34 papers). Richard L. Naeye is often cited by papers focused on Birth, Development, and Health (43 papers), Pregnancy and preeclampsia studies (42 papers) and Neonatal Respiratory Health Research (34 papers). Richard L. Naeye collaborates with scholars based in United States, Ethiopia and South Africa. Richard L. Naeye's co-authors include William A. Blanc, Nebiat Tafari, Samuel M. Ross, Charles C. Marboe, M. Jeffrey Maisels, H. Theodore Harcke, David L. Wright, Dorothy Tatter, David M. Judge and Jack W. C. Hagstrom and has published in prestigious journals such as Science, New England Journal of Medicine and The Lancet.
